Explosion near Jamia Masjid Sgr

Srinagar: An explosion took place near historic Jamia Masjid in downtown Srinagar on Thursday, but there was no report of any casualty, official sources said.

They said panic gripped Nowhatta area in Srinagar while people ran for safety when a blast took place near Jamia Masjid on Thursday afternoon.

”Security forces deployed in the area also fired some shots in the air after the explosion,” they said.

They said no one was injured in the incident.

”Following the blast, additional security forces were rushed to the area and all the roads leading to the historic mosque were sealed,” they said.

They said forensic teams were rushed to the spot to ascertain the material used in the blast. ”More details are awaited,” they added.

The blast took place at a time when security forces have been deployed in strength in Srinagar and other parts of Kashmir valley in view of the second anniversary of the abrogation of special status of erstwhile state of J&K.

The Centre on August 5, 2019 abrogated Article 370 and divided the erstwhile state into two Union Territories (UTs) – J&K and Ladakh. (UNI)
